Career path

Geospatial Programming Career Outlook (UK)

Geospatial Data Scientist

Develops advanced algorithms and models using geospatial data for insights. High demand for GIS and Python skills.

GIS Analyst

Collects, analyzes, and visualizes geospatial data using GIS software. Strong GIS software expertise is crucial.

Remote Sensing Specialist

Processes and interprets satellite and aerial imagery. Expertise in remote sensing techniques is essential.

Geospatial Programmer/Developer

Builds and maintains geospatial applications and software. Proficient in programming languages like Python and JavaScript.
